Increased bcl-2 protein levels in rat primary astrocyte culture following chronic lithium treatment
IJMS-Iranian Journal of Medical Sciences. 2013; 38 (3): 255-262
in English | IMEMR | ID: emr-177164
ABSTRACT

Background:

B cell CLL/lymphoma 2 protein, bcl-2, is an important anti-apoptotic factor that has been implicated in lithium's neuroprotective effect. However, most studies have focused on assessing the effects of lithium in neurons, ignoring examination of bcl-2 in astrocytes, which also influence neuronal survival and are affected in bipolar disorder. The aim of this study was to evaluate whether chronic lithium treatment also elevates bcl-2 expression in astrocytes compared with neuronal and mixed neuron-astrocyte cultures
